Nonalcoholic

/ˌnɒn.ælkəˈhɒl.ɪk/

Meaning & Definition

adjective
Not containing alcohol; referring to beverages or products that are free from alcohol.
She ordered a nonalcoholic drink at the party since she was the designated driver.
Pertaining to substances or drinks that do not include alcoholic content.
The restaurant offers a variety of nonalcoholic options for those who prefer to avoid alcohol.
Describing activities or events that do not involve alcohol consumption.
They hosted a nonalcoholic gathering to promote a healthy lifestyle.

Etymology

The prefix 'non-' meaning 'not' combined with 'alcoholic', relating to alcohol.
